Cashback is not designed to be Instant

The first big myth is that cashback needs to be immediate. Often, cash back follows after a verification cycle.

Behind the scenes, this happens:

  • The merchant confirms the transaction.
  • Eligibility is validated by the payment partner.
  • Cash back is released by the bank/wallet.

The whole process can take time from 7-90 days, depending on:

  • Type of offer.
  • Merchant policy.
  • Return or refund windows.

Cashback is often marked as:

Tracked → Pending → Confirmed → Credited

Key take-away: Delay is not always denial, more often than not, it is processing.

Returns, Cancellations, or Partial Refunds Cancel Cashback

Cash back is rewarded for completed transactions.

If the following applies to you:

  • Cancel order.
  • Return the product.
  • Get a partial refund.

then the cashback system may automatically deny the reward.

Even small acts such as:

  • Replacing an item.
  • Delivery location change.
  • Applying a price adjustment.

can break cashback eligibility.

Important: Cash back programs typically check the status of orders after the end of the return window.

Tracking Failure Due to Cookies or App Switching

The cashback process relies heavily on digital tracking systems.

Common issues that can result in a breach of tracking:

  • Switching the apps.
  • Opening the product in a browser rather than in an application.
  • Eliminar cookies.
  • Ad blockers or private browsers.
  • Payment using a different payments app than required.

In the absence of tracing the purchase sources, cash-back rewards could remain untracked altogether.

Restrictions or Issues Related to Account Level

Cash rewards may be specific to the user.

Cashback could fail if:

  • If you have previously used this offer.
  • If Offer is new-user.
  • Wallet KYC is incomplete.
  • Payment account – flagged for high refunds.
  • If there are multiple accounts used.

Some sites automatically deduct cash back for accounts which display “abuse patterns” regardless of the purchases being legitimate.
